I've been debating if I should mount the fog lights in the bumper under the marker lights. I think the bumper will look too cluttered with a light bar and two fog lights. I may just mount them in the plastic air dam on the side of the tow hooks. Fog lights are of no use if they are mounted to high on the front of a vehicle.

update on my "project".

I decided to build a simple light bar that mounts to the frame where the tow hooks go. Here is a teaser pic of it. I think the bar is sitting a few inches to high and I may lower it so it sits just above the license plate frame. I have no choice but to flip my tow hooks 180 degrees otherwise they would hit the mounting bolts. I still need to acquire stainless hardware as well as weld on my mounting tabs for the LED bar mounting bracket. This bar will have a 30" Rigid light bar on it.

Yes, I went with Rigid. The Digidiodes light bars as well as all the other cheap ones out there are junk!! You buy cheap you get cheap. Those cheap ones use 2.5 watt LEDs and cheap flat reflective bulb style lenses. I have seen them in person and they do not even compare to the Rigid ones. Besides, the biggest gripe about the cheap ones are the moisture that gets into them creating a foggy haze behind the outer protective lens.
